James Milner Could Join Manchester City

Versatile English midfielder James Milner is believed to have found Manchester City offer too lucrative to reject and could move to Eastland this summer. Reports out in the media suggest that Milner is planning to make a written request to Aston Villa to let him move to Manchester City.

Manchester City is ready to splash £28 million in cash for the England international who is now in South Africa with England’s World Cup squad. Aston Villa is understood to be disappointed at such request as they have no intention to lose their most prized asset.

James Milner is a highly talented player who can play as a winger as well as a central or left-sided midfielder. His excellent performance was instrumental in Aston Villa’s race to clinch a top four finish, and thus, a Champions League spot. At last, Villa finished 6th in the point table, 6 points behind the fourth-placed Tottenham Hotspur.

James Milner has showed his excellent form in England’s recent 1-0 victory over Slovenia in the World Cup and there are some other clubs who are also interested to secure his service.

However, Manchester City is believed to be in pole position in the race and it seems the club has offered Milner a very lucrative weekly wage that would be hard for the player to resist.
